
ANDERS BREIVIK AND THE CULTURE OF DELUSION
by Kenan Malik
‘We want to create a European version of al-Qaeda’, the ‘most successful revolutionary movement in the world’. So claimed Anders Behring Breivik at his trial in Oslo last week. In his sick, twisted, paranoid fantasy world, Breivik sees himself as warrior defending Christian Europe against a Muslim invasion. Yet, nothing so resembles Breivik’s mindset as that of an Islamist jihadist.
